Certification in Project Management
Course Overview:
Project Management is the application of appropriate management strategies to effectively coordinate complex and dynamic projects. This program aims to develop knowledge of project management practices in terms of synergistic and logical approach in defining and achieving project objectives, managing projects, planning, implementing and successfully closing the projects.
This course consists of
- 18 modules.
- 2 Case Studies.
- 1 Assessment.
Learning Objective:
The objective of the course is:
- To equip candidates with comprehensive understanding of project management principles.
- Develop a critical appreciation of the role and responsibilities of the Project Manager.
- To engender management techniques available to project managers.
- To recognize the importance of formal procedure in successful project management.
Learning Outcomes:
- Determine effective ways of integrating project management and general business management in an organization.
- Apply the technical and commercial knowledge and skills to manage a project successfully.
- Appraise the importance of people management and team work.
- Critically appraise client requirements and factors that are critical to the success of a project.
- Identify and evaluate project risk and develop control strategies.
